The threat is a project of the Russian complex of a corrected aviation missile weapon developed for use on military aircraft and helicopters to improve the accuracy of combat use of unguided missile weapons. In publications of foreign countries it has the name RCIC (“Russian Concept of Impulse Correction”).

The composition of the complex
The complex includes adjustable missiles S-5Kor (caliber - 57 mm), C-8Kor (80 mm) and C-13Kor (120 mm), created on the basis of unguided C-5, C-8 and C-13 aircraft for due to the additional equipping of them with semi-active homing laser systems [1] .
In the process of producing missiles, the missile’s warhead is equipped with detachable warheads in flight, the stabilization of which is carried out by means of a drop-down tail. The C-5cor rocket has four petal plumage and is revealed by means of a spring, while the C-8cor and C-13core - plumage consists of six petals and is revealed by means of a gas piston. The homing system allows to hit small ground targets (tanks, infantry fighting vehicles, armored personnel carriers) of all types [1] .
For aiming at the target, laser illumination of the target is required (lasting about 1 s). The target may be illuminated by a carrier aircraft (helicopter carrier), another aircraft, or from the ground by a target-pointer pointer. The flight of the warhead is corrected by impulse rocket engines. In order to increase the probability of hitting a target, the use of a volley of missiles is proposed [1] .
Development
The complex of corrected aviation missile weapons "Threat" was developed on the basis of RCIC-technology STC JSC "AMETECH" ("Automation and mechanization of technology"). In 1999, the complex was presented at the International Aviation and Space Salon MAKS-99 . In Western publications, the project was named RCIC - “Russian Concept of Impulse Correction” [1] .
Performance characteristics
| Rocket | S-5kor | S-8kor | S-13kor |
|---|---|---|---|
| Head part | VM-5 | VM-8 | VM-13 |
| Head weight, kg | 5.85 | 6 | - |
| Weight of explosives of a warhead (TNT equivalent), kg | 0.5 | 1.5 | 7 |
| Penetration, mm | 200 | 400 | |
| Firing range, m | 2500-7000 | 2500-7000 | 2500-9000 |
| Accuracy of shooting (KVO) , m | 0.8-1.8 | 0.8-1.8 | 0.8-1.8 |
| Launchers | UB-16-57, UB-16-57U, UB-16-57UM, UB-16-57UD, UB-16-57UDDM, UB-32, UB-32A, UB-32A-24, UB-32-57U, UB-32M, B-32, UB-8 | B-8, B-8M, B-8M1, B-8B7, B-8B8, B-8B20, B-8V20A | B-13L, B-13R |
